About The Position

The Michigan Milk Producers Association (MMPA) is a dairy farmer-owned cooperative and processor founded in 1916. MMPA serves dairy farmers across Michigan, Indiana, Ohio, and Wisconsin, with strategic business relationships and processing capabilities for various dairy products. This role is for a detail-oriented and reliable Data Entry Clerk to support ERP system data entry within a fast-paced production environment at their Remus, MI plant. The position is responsible for accurately entering, updating, and maintaining production, inventory, and operational data in the company’s Enterprise Resource Planning (ERP) system, Microsoft D365. Responsibilities

  • Accurately enter and update production orders, inventory transactions, and material movements into the ERP system.
  • Process bills of materials (BOMs), routings, and work order data.
  • Verify production data against source documents (shop floor paperwork, inventory logs, shipping/receiving records).
  • Assist with maintaining item master data, part numbers, and product specifications.
  • Support cycle counts and physical inventory reconciliations.
  • Monitor data integrity and report discrepancies to supervisors.
  • Generate routine production and inventory reports as needed.
  • Collaborate with production supervisors, warehouse staff, purchasing, and accounting to ensure data accuracy.
  • Maintain organized digital and physical records in compliance with company policies.
  • Adhere to company safety standards and production protocols.
